Mao Shan Movies

  • 1973
    A Sword Renounced

    A Sword Renounced

    A Sword Renounced

    5.51973HD

    Also known as The Blind Swordsman's Revenge, this is Zatoichi Versus The Flying Guillotine (1972). Zatoichi is "born Wu Ching Hui, he was kidnapped...

    A Sword Renounced
  • 1971
    The Devilish Killer

    The Devilish Killer

    The Devilish Killer

    01971HD

    The Devilish Killer is the most dangerous fighter that ever lived...After defeating all of China’s martial art factions in a grand battle, he...

    The Devilish Killer